Its a good month for boxing
8th > Calzaghe V Jones
15th > Haye V Barrett (heavyweight Debut for Haye)
22nd > Hatton V Mallinaggi (Matthew Hatton V Ben Tackie on undercard)
Then >
6th December > De La Hoya V Pacquiao

Mallinaggi's performance was a joke, along with his hair extensions (which had to be cut off)
I had N'dou up on points & lets remember one thing - PM knackered his hand in this fight, something which may come back to haunt him & N'dou isn't half as tough as RH
Mallinaggi has only lost once (points loss) against Cotto which was a bloody joke performance anyway! how an earth he thinks he'll out point Hatton is beyond me, he is a good boxer (and thats it!) but has no where near the same power or brains as Hatton (saying that - I hope Hatton keeps his head in this fight & we dont see another FM jnr loss through rushing the knockout )
I've been watching some videos on youtube of Hatton training with Mayweather SNR & he's looking in good shape, not far off his weight either which has to be a first more so as he doesn't have Kerry Kayes in his team anymore to manage this
One thing i did notice tho, in the early days with FM snr, he looked a bit awkward in their training sessions, but as with everything it'll take time to adjust to a different trainer - some interesting articles on www.skysports.com at the moment in the boxing pages
I wish Matthew Hatton well against his fight with Ben Tackie (who RH fought a few years back). Tackie has never been stopped, i just wish Matthew would come out from under Ricky's shadow - maybe his career would take off a little more then as he's a good boxer
